What Essential Features Should You Look for in Sunglasses for Golf?

When selecting the best sunglasses for seeing the golf ball, several essential features should be considered to enhance your performance on the course.

  • Lens Color: The color of the lenses affects how you perceive contrast and depth on the golf course. Gray lenses are great for reducing overall brightness without distorting colors, while amber or yellow lenses enhance contrast and allow for better visibility of the golf ball against green grass.
  • UV Protection: High UV protection is crucial for safeguarding your eyes from harmful rays during long hours spent outdoors. Look for sunglasses that offer 100% UVA and UVB protection to reduce the risk of eye damage and ensure comfort while playing.
  • Polarization: Polarized lenses reduce glare from reflective surfaces, such as water or wet grass, which can be particularly distracting when trying to focus on the golf ball. This feature helps improve visual clarity and comfort, making it easier to track the ball’s movement.
  • Fit and Comfort: A good fit is essential for optimal performance; sunglasses should stay securely on your face without slipping during your swing. Look for lightweight frames and adjustable nose pads to ensure comfort over extended periods of wear.
  • Anti-Fog Coating: An anti-fog coating can be a game-changer, especially in humid conditions or when transitioning from hot to cold environments. This feature helps maintain clear vision by preventing condensation buildup on the lenses.
  • Impact Resistance: Golf can involve fast-moving objects, and sunglasses should be able to withstand potential impacts. Look for lenses made from polycarbonate or other impact-resistant materials to protect your eyes from accidental hits.
  • Wraparound Design: A wraparound style provides additional coverage and minimizes peripheral light interference, which can be distracting while focusing on the golf ball. This design also helps to keep the sunglasses secure during swings and movements.

How Do Different Lens Colors Impact the Visibility of a Golf Ball?

Different lens colors can significantly affect how well a golfer can see the ball against varying backgrounds and lighting conditions.

  • Yellow/Gold Lenses: These lenses enhance contrast and depth perception, making them ideal for bright conditions. They filter out blue light, which can help golfers better see the white golf ball against green grass or blue skies.
  • Brown/Amber Lenses: Brown or amber lenses improve contrast and reduce glare, which can be beneficial on sunny days. They also enhance the definition of the golf ball and the course, allowing players to track the ball’s movement more easily.
  • Grey Lenses: Grey lenses reduce overall brightness without distorting colors, making them suitable for extremely sunny conditions. While they provide a natural color perception, they may not enhance contrast as much as yellow or brown lenses, which can affect visibility under certain lighting.
  • Green Lenses: Green lenses provide good glare reduction and enhance contrast, helping players see both the ball and the course clearly. They are suitable for varying light conditions and can help golfers maintain color perception while reducing eye strain.
  • Clear Lenses: Clear lenses are best used in low-light conditions or overcast days. They offer maximum visibility without altering color perception, making them a versatile choice when sunlight is not a factor.

How Do Polarized Lenses Improve Vision for Golfers?

Polarized lenses enhance vision for golfers by reducing glare and improving visual clarity on the course.

  • Glare Reduction: Polarized lenses are designed to filter out horizontal light waves, which are responsible for the blinding glare that can bounce off water, wet grass, or shiny surfaces. This reduction in glare allows golfers to see the ball more clearly, helping them focus on their swing and alignment.
  • Improved Contrast: These lenses also enhance contrast, making it easier for golfers to distinguish between the golf ball and its surroundings. By providing a clearer view of the ball against the green grass or blue sky, polarized lenses enable better tracking of the ball’s flight and landing.
  • Enhanced Comfort: Wearing polarized sunglasses can significantly reduce eye strain and fatigue during long rounds of golf. By minimizing the harshness of bright sunlight, golfers can maintain better focus and comfort throughout their game.
  • True Color Perception: Polarized lenses help in maintaining true color perception, allowing golfers to better judge distances and the contours of the green. This accurate color representation aids in making informed decisions about club selection and shot placement.

How Can You Ensure Your Golf Sunglasses Fit Comfortably and Securely?

Ensuring that your golf sunglasses fit comfortably and securely can greatly enhance your performance on the course.

  • Correct Frame Size: Choosing the right frame size is crucial for comfort and stability. Sunglasses that are too large may slide down your nose, while those that are too small can pinch and cause discomfort.
  • Adjustable Nose Pads: Sunglasses with adjustable nose pads allow for a customized fit, ensuring they sit securely without slipping. This feature is especially beneficial for players who might sweat during a game, as it helps maintain grip and comfort.
  • Wraparound Style: Wraparound sunglasses provide a snug fit around the temples, which helps prevent light from entering from the sides. This design not only enhances protection against UV rays but also keeps the glasses secure during movement, which is important for an active sport like golf.
  • Lightweight Materials: Sunglasses made from lightweight materials such as polycarbonate or titanium are less likely to cause discomfort during long periods of wear. Lightweight frames are easier to forget you’re wearing them, allowing you to focus more on your game.
  • Non-Slip Temple Tips: Look for sunglasses that feature non-slip temple tips to ensure they stay in place as you swing. These tips grip your head better and help prevent the glasses from sliding, especially during vigorous movements.
